What Features Should a Beginner Consider When Choosing a 220V Welder?

When selecting the best beginning 220V welder, beginners should consider several important features to ensure they choose a suitable and effective machine.

  • Power Output: The power output of a welder is crucial for determining its ability to weld different materials and thicknesses. A welder with adjustable power settings allows beginners to start with lower power for thin materials and gradually increase as they gain confidence and skill.
  • Type of Welding: Different types of welding include MIG, TIG, and stick welding, each with its own advantages. Beginners may prefer MIG welding for its ease of use and versatility, as it allows for quicker learning and faster projects.
  • Portability: A lightweight and compact welder is beneficial for beginners who may need to move their equipment frequently or work in different locations. Portability ensures that the welder can be transported easily without compromising on performance.
  • Ease of Setup and Use: Beginners should look for welders that are user-friendly and come with straightforward instructions. Features like easy-to-read displays, clear controls, and pre-set functions can significantly reduce setup time and enhance the learning experience.
  • Safety Features: Safety is paramount in welding, so beginners should choose welders equipped with features like thermal overload protection and automatic shut-off. These safety mechanisms help prevent accidents and equipment damage, allowing for a more secure working environment.
  • Welding Accessories: Consideration of included accessories such as welding helmets, gloves, and cables is important. A welder that comes as a complete kit can save beginners time and additional costs while ensuring they have everything needed to start welding immediately.
  • Warranty and Support: A good warranty and customer support can provide peace of mind for beginners. A longer warranty period may indicate the manufacturer’s confidence in their product, and accessible support can be invaluable for troubleshooting and learning.

How Do Different Types of Welders Cater to Beginners?

Different types of welders offer unique features that cater to beginners, especially when looking for the best beginning 220v welder.

  • MIG Welders: MIG (Metal Inert Gas) welders are often recommended for beginners due to their ease of use and versatility. They use a wire feed system that continuously feeds a spool of wire into the weld pool, allowing for a smooth and consistent weld with minimal skill required.
  • TIG Welders: TIG (Tungsten Inert Gas) welders provide a more precise welding process, which can be beneficial for beginners wanting to learn intricate techniques. Although they require more skill than MIG welders, they offer greater control over the weld and can be used on a variety of materials.
  • Stick Welders: Stick welders, or SMAW (Shielded Metal Arc Welding), are a traditional option that is relatively simple and inexpensive, making them accessible for beginners. They are great for outdoor use and can weld thick materials, but they may require more practice to master the technique compared to MIG and TIG welding.
  • Multi-Process Welders: Multi-process welders combine capabilities for MIG, TIG, and Stick welding in one machine, making them versatile choices for beginners. They allow new welders to experiment with different welding styles and techniques without having to invest in multiple machines.
  • Inverter Welders: Inverter welders are compact and lightweight, making them perfect for beginners who need portability. They also typically offer advanced features such as adjustable settings and better energy efficiency, which can help new welders achieve good results more easily.

How Important Is Safety for New Users in 220V Welding?

Safety is paramount for new users in 220V welding, as it involves high voltage and potential hazards.

  • Protective Gear: New welders should always wear appropriate protective gear, including a welding helmet, gloves, and flame-resistant clothing.
  • Ventilation: Adequate ventilation is crucial to prevent the buildup of harmful fumes and gases that can be produced during welding.
  • Electrical Safety: Understanding the electrical components and ensuring that all equipment is properly grounded can significantly reduce the risk of electric shock.
  • Fire Safety: Having fire extinguishing equipment nearby and being aware of flammable materials in the workspace is essential to prevent fires.
  • Training and Guidelines: New users should seek proper training and familiarize themselves with safety guidelines to mitigate risks associated with welding.

Protective gear is essential for safeguarding the welder from harmful UV rays, sparks, and heat generated during the welding process. A welding helmet protects the face and eyes, while gloves and flame-resistant clothing provide a barrier against burns and injuries.

Ventilation is necessary to ensure that harmful fumes and smoke produced during welding do not accumulate in the workspace. Good airflow helps to maintain a safe environment and reduces the risk of respiratory issues.

Electrical safety includes understanding how to operate welding equipment safely and recognizing the importance of using properly rated extension cords and outlets. Ensuring that equipment is grounded helps prevent electric shocks, which can be fatal.

Fire safety is critical because welding can ignite nearby materials, leading to dangerous fires. Keeping fire extinguishers readily available and ensuring a clear workspace free from flammable items can mitigate this risk.

Training and guidelines are vital for new users to understand the risks associated with welding and learn best practices for safety. Proper instruction helps build confidence and competence, allowing beginners to operate welding equipment safely and effectively.

What Common Mistakes Should Beginners Avoid with 220V Welders?

Beginners using 220V welders often encounter several common mistakes that can hinder their welding experience and outcomes.

  • Not Understanding the Equipment: Many beginners fail to read the manual and understand the specific functions and settings of their welder, which can lead to improper use.
  • Ignoring Safety Precautions: Neglecting safety gear, such as gloves, helmets, and protective clothing, is a frequent oversight that can result in injuries.
  • Improper Material Preparation: Beginners often skip or inadequately prepare the materials they are welding, which can affect the quality of the weld.
  • Incorrect Settings: Choosing the wrong voltage or amperage settings for the material being welded can lead to poor penetration or burn-through.
  • Lack of Practice: Many new welders underestimate the need for practice, which is essential for developing skill and confidence.
  • Not Checking for Voltage Compatibility: Some beginners fail to ensure that their power supply matches the 220V requirement of their welder, leading to operational issues.
  • Neglecting Maintenance: Regular maintenance of the welder, including cleaning and checking for wear, is often overlooked, which can affect performance and longevity.

Not understanding the equipment can lead to frustration and ineffective welding. It’s important for beginners to familiarize themselves with their welder’s manual to understand its capabilities and limitations.

Ignoring safety precautions puts beginners at risk of serious injuries. Always wearing appropriate safety gear, such as a welding helmet, gloves, and protective clothing, is crucial when operating a welder.

Improper material preparation can significantly impact the weld quality. Ensuring that surfaces are clean and free of contaminants is essential for achieving strong and durable welds.

Incorrect settings can result in inadequate welding performance. Beginners should learn how to adjust the voltage and amperage according to the thickness and type of material being welded to achieve optimal results.

Lack of practice is a common pitfall. Welding is a skill that requires time and repetition to master, so beginners should allocate time for practice to build their confidence and technique.

Not checking for voltage compatibility can lead to operational failures. It’s essential to verify that the power supply matches the welder’s specifications to avoid damage to the equipment.

Neglecting maintenance can lead to decreased performance and potential hazards. Regularly cleaning and inspecting the welder ensures it operates efficiently and lasts longer, helping beginners avoid costly repairs.

How Can Beginners Maximize Their Welding Skills with 220V Welders?

Beginners can maximize their welding skills with 220V welders by focusing on the right equipment, techniques, and safety practices.

  • Choosing the Right Welder: Selecting a 220V welder that suits your needs and skill level is crucial. Look for models that offer versatility, ease of use, and consistent performance, such as MIG or TIG welders, which are often recommended for beginners due to their forgiving nature and ability to produce clean welds.
  • Understanding Welding Techniques: Familiarizing yourself with various welding techniques is essential for skill development. Beginners should practice basic techniques like stringer beads, weave patterns, and proper travel speed to enhance their proficiency and ensure strong welds.
  • Investing in Quality Safety Gear: Safety should always be a priority when welding. Essential gear includes a welding helmet, gloves, and protective clothing to shield against sparks and UV radiation, enabling you to work confidently and focus on honing your skills.
  • Practicing on Scrap Metal: Utilizing scrap metal for practice is an effective way to build confidence and technique. Regularly experimenting with different settings and weld types on scrap pieces allows beginners to learn from mistakes without the pressure of working on a critical project.
  • Learning from Online Resources: Taking advantage of online tutorials, forums, and instructional videos can greatly enhance your learning curve. Many experienced welders share tips and tricks that can help beginners troubleshoot common issues and improve their techniques quickly.
  • Joining a Welding Class or Community: Participating in a local welding class or community can provide valuable hands-on experience and mentorship. Learning alongside others allows beginners to gain insights from more experienced welders and receive constructive feedback on their work.
  • Regular Maintenance of Equipment: Keeping your 220V welder in good condition is essential for optimal performance. Regularly checking connections, cleaning the nozzle, and ensuring proper gas flow will help avoid issues and ensure consistent weld quality as you practice.
